a metal object when fully dispersed in water displaces 2 litres of water. what is the loss in the weight of water.and calculate the buoyant force​

Answer:

according to Archimedes principle the loss in weight is equal to amount of water displaced. here the amount of water displaced is 2 litre. show the loss in weight it is equals to 2 units(kg or gram). the buoyant force will be 2 into 9.8 equals 19.6 N.
